Understanding FDA Lyophilization Guidance: What You Need To Know

The Food and Drug Administration (FDA) plays a crucial role in ensuring the safety and efficacy of pharmaceutical products through stringent regulations and guidelines One such important guidance provided by the FDA is related to the process of lyophilization, also known as freeze-drying This article delves into the FDA lyophilization guidance and provides insights into what it entails for pharmaceutical manufacturers.

Lyophilization is a widely used process in the pharmaceutical industry for the preservation of drugs, biologics, and other products that are sensitive to heat or moisture The process involves freezing the product at very low temperatures and then removing the ice through sublimation under vacuum conditions The resulting dried product has enhanced stability and a longer shelf life compared to conventional liquid formulations.

The FDA recognizes the importance of lyophilization in the development of pharmaceutical products and has issued guidance to ensure that the process is conducted in a manner that maintains product quality, safety, and efficacy The FDA lyophilization guidance provides recommendations on various aspects of the process, including equipment design, process validation, and product stability testing.

One of the key elements of the FDA lyophilization guidance is the requirement for manufacturers to develop a robust lyophilization cycle that is validated to ensure consistency and product quality This involves determining the optimal combination of freezing, primary drying, and secondary drying parameters to achieve the desired product characteristics Manufacturers are also required to perform rigorous testing to demonstrate that the lyophilized product meets specifications for potency, purity, and stability.

Manufacturers are advised to perform regular calibration and monitoring of critical process parameters, such as temperature and pressure, to prevent deviations that could compromise product quality.

The FDA also provides recommendations for container closure systems used in lyophilization to ensure product sterility and integrity Manufacturers are required to select appropriate vials and stoppers that are compatible with the lyophilization process and demonstrate compatibility through container closure integrity testing Proper sealing of containers is crucial to prevent contamination and maintain product stability during storage.

Another important aspect of the FDA lyophilization guidance is the requirement for manufacturers to conduct stability testing to assess the shelf life of lyophilized products under various storage conditions This involves monitoring the physical and chemical characteristics of the product over time to ensure that it remains safe and effective for use Stability testing helps manufacturers establish expiration dates and storage recommendations for their products.
